SSIS(SQL Server Integration Services)是微软SQL Server数据库管理系统中的一种数据集成和工作流解决方案。它提供了一套强大的工具和服务,用于数据提取、转换和加载(ETL)操作,以及数据仓库的构建和管理。
SSIS的主要功能包括:
- 数据提取:从各种数据源(如数据库、文件、Web服务等)中提取数据。
- 数据转换:对提取的数据进行清洗、转换和整合,以满足目标系统的要求。
- 数据加载:将转换后的数据加载到目标系统(如数据仓库、数据库等)中。
- 工作流管理:通过可视化的方式创建和管理数据集成的工作流程。
SSIS的优势:
- 强大的数据集成能力:SSIS提供了丰富的数据提取、转换和加载功能,可以满足各种复杂的数据集成需求。
- 可视化的开发环境:SSIS提供了图形化的开发工具,使开发人员可以通过拖拽和连接组件来构建数据集成的工作流程,降低了开发的复杂度。
- 可扩展性和灵活性:SSIS支持自定义组件和脚本任务,开发人员可以根据需要扩展和定制功能。
- 高性能和可靠性:SSIS具有优化的数据处理引擎,能够处理大量的数据,并提供了故障恢复和错误处理机制,保证数据集成的高性能和可靠性。
SSIS的应用场景:
- 数据仓库和商业智能:SSIS可以用于构建和管理数据仓库,实现数据的提取、转换和加载,为企业提供决策支持和商业智能分析。
- 数据迁移和同步:SSIS可以用于将数据从一个系统迁移到另一个系统,或者实现不同系统之间的数据同步。
- 数据清洗和整合:SSIS可以对数据进行清洗、转换和整合,提高数据的质量和一致性。
- ETL流程自动化:SSIS可以自动化执行ETL流程,减少人工干预,提高效率和准确性。
腾讯云相关产品推荐:
腾讯云数据传输服务(Data Transmission Service,DTS):https://cloud.tencent.com/product/dts
腾讯云数据仓库(TencentDB for TDSQL):https://cloud.tencent.com/product/tdsql
腾讯云大数据计算服务(TencentDB for TDSQL):https://cloud.tencent.com/product/emr
腾讯云云托管数据库(TencentDB for TDSQL):https://cloud.tencent.com/product/cdb